Methodological recommendations on the application of Iverlong long acting preparation in the presence of parasitic diseases of livestock animals are given, including general data, pharmacological properties, application procedure and personal preventive measures. Iverlong is prescribed to cattle and sheep for the treatment and prophylaxis of nematodosis (dictyocaulosis, strongylatosis, strongyloidosis, neoascaridosis, bunostomosis, thelaziosis), gasterophilidae invasions (hypodermatosis, oestrosis), psoroptic scab, sarcoptic scab, sifunculatosis. Iverlong is administered to the animals as a single dose intramuscularly or subcutaneously to cattle on brachium, it is administered to sheep in the internal surface of thigh in a dose of 1 ml per 50 kg of body weight. Iverlong provides protection of animal from parasitic diseases up to 75-90 days.
